During each NBA league year, teams face limits on the amount of cash they can send out and receive in trades. Once they reach those limits, they’re no longer permitted to include cash in a deal until the following league year.
For the 2025/26 NBA season, thelimit is$7,964,000.
The limits on sending and receiving cash are separate and aren’t dependent on one another, so if a team sends out $7,964,000 in one trade, then receives $7,964,000 in another, they aren’t back to square one — they’ve reached both limits for the season and can’t make another deal that includes cash.
Adding cash to a deal can serve multiple purposes. It can be a sweetener to encourage a team to make a deal in the first place – like when a club acquires a second-round pick in exchange for cash, or sends out an unwanted contract along with cash – or it can be a necessity to meet CBA requirements.
Teams operating above the secondtax apron are prohibited from sending out cash in a trade. For the time being, that restriction applies to one teams: Cleveland. TheCavaliers could only send out cash if they dip below the second apron.
